Output 71498faa69b8b249afbe28e5626229f7c28e82038c78ae1fefcb42877996957f:6

value
439373
script pubkey
OP_0 OP_PUSHBYTES_20 00058b108731f02ea73b6b0f9044bd2e266cd16c
address
bc1qqqzckyy8x8czafemdv8eq39a9cnxe5tv2jtpa6
transaction
71498faa69b8b249afbe28e5626229f7c28e82038c78ae1fefcb42877996957f
confirmations
286827
spent
true